Output 3d8536c28394b0070cfa829ae2e046302b0ae2a1b08bff126f044e21f2663e31:0

value
31092919
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7fd98fe6a323a14d05af9be3c19585dd4f3bdde2 OP_EQUAL
address
3DM2NPPaLg5f5ojDGg9zvDsc3fwwgXcJ3P
transaction
3d8536c28394b0070cfa829ae2e046302b0ae2a1b08bff126f044e21f2663e31